Question:

If a + b + c = 7 and ab + bc + ca = -6, then the value of a3 + b3 + c3 − 3abc is:

Options:

469

472

463

479

Correct Answer:

469

Explanation:

If x + y  = n

then, $x^3 + y^3$ = n3 - 3 × n × xy

If a + b + c = 7

ab + bc + ca = -6

Then the value of a3 + b3 + c3 − 3abc = ?

If the number of equations are less than the number of variables then we can put the extra variables according to our choice = 

So here two equations given and three variables are present so put c = 0

If a + b = 7

ab  = -6

Then the value of a3 + b3 = 73 - 3 × 7 × -6

a3 + b3 = 469
